That was a small sow...Sometimes it was hard to tell which was which....I doubt she weighed a hundred pounds...
I would say that the eastern hunts are at least a couple weeks out...I think most wait until May and good weather before making the trip...
I figure this one was a boar cub...Kinda hard to tell from the pic,but he was sitting on his butt scratching his you know what.. 
For you guys that seen our hunts from last year,this is Quinn...He has successfully completed his hunter safety and Sunday was his first big game hunt ever...We took the bullets from his gun and had him find a good shooting position and practice sight picture and squeeze...Much better practice than targets...The adreneline was up with bear in the scope....Now when a better bear shows up,he will know what it feels like to see a bear in the scope and make a good shot..
Thats his dad doing the coaching...
